• A groundbreaking examine challenges standard perception about menopause — A latest examine revealed in Science Advances, led by researchers from the Penn State College, took a better have a look at how human egg cells change with age. Their aim was to determine if these cells accumulate mtDNA mutations because of the getting older course of.2
• What the researchers checked out — The analysis group analyzed 80 single oocytes from 22 girls aged 20 to 42 who had been present process in-vitro fertilization (IVF) therapy. In addition they examined the ladies’s blood and saliva to match how mitochondrial DNA (mtDNA) mutations amassed throughout totally different tissues.
The researchers used a cutting-edge approach referred to as duplex sequencing, which is extremely correct and able to detecting even ultra-rare mutations that older strategies may miss.
• What the info revealed — The examine authors discovered that whereas blood and saliva confirmed the anticipated improve in mtDNA mutations with age, egg cells didn’t. No matter whether or not a lady was 22 or 42, her oocytes maintained comparable ranges of mitochondrial genetic stability.
This discovering means that, not like different cells within the physique, human egg cells have mechanisms in place to guard their mitochondrial DNA from age-related injury. This protecting impact appears to final at the least by way of the early 40s.
“In oocytes, mutations with excessive allele frequencies had been much less prevalent in coding than noncoding areas, whereas mutations with low allele frequencies had been extra uniformly distributed alongside the mtDNA, suggesting frequency-dependent purifying choice,” the examine authors mentioned.
“Thus, mtDNA in human oocytes is protected in opposition to accumulation of mutations with getting older and having useful penalties. These findings are notably well timed as people have a tendency to breed later in life.”

• Researchers from a number of research at the moment are confirming this — In 2021, a small examine revealed in Menopause journal discovered that injecting a mixture of platelet-rich plasma (PRP) and follicle-stimulating hormone (FSH) immediately into the ovaries reveals promise in restoring ovarian operate in girls with early menopause.5 In accordance with a commentary on Medscape:
“[M]enstruation resumed inside a imply of about 5 weeks for 11 of 12 sufferers with early menopause who had been handled with the approach. One affected person achieved a scientific being pregnant.”6
• There are additionally rising regenerative drugs methods for treating untimely ovarian insufficiency (POI) — This can be a situation during which a lady’s ovaries lose regular operate earlier than age 40, resulting in infertility, hormonal issues, and lowered follicle rely. In accordance with animal research, utilizing stem cells could restore ovarian tissue operate.7

• Intraovarian platelet-rich plasma (PRP) remedy — Probably the most talked-about approaches at this time, this technique makes use of an individual’s personal blood, spun right down to isolate platelets, that are then injected immediately into the ovaries. There are revealed case research the place PRP has restarted menstrual cycles in postmenopausal girls and improved hormonal markers like estrogen and anti-Müllerian hormone (AMH).9 Some even went on to conceive naturally or with IVF.
• Stem cell remedy — As talked about within the earlier part, there’s analysis exhibiting success in utilizing stem cells in girls identified with POI. Preclinical research point out MSCs could assist restore ovarian tissue operate by selling follicle survival and development, enhancing hormone manufacturing, decreasing irritation, and facilitating tissue regeneration by way of paracrine signaling and immunomodulation.10
